The boyish-looking MacArthur continued with rites-of-passage roles into his late 20s a newly-qualified doctor in The Interns (1962); a young graduate trying to escape his poor rural background in Spencer's Mountain (1963); a rich boy undergoing a baptism of fire as a soldier forced to fight the Japanese in Cry of Battle (1963); the edgy, eager ensign who accidentally starts the third world war in the cold-war drama The Bedford Incident (1965), and a voyager giving Hayley Mills her first and second screen kisses in The Truth About Spring (1965). He was just 7 months old when the First Lady of American Theatre, Helen Hayes, and her famous playwright husband, Charles MacArthur, (famous for his collaborative work with Ben Hecht), adopted him and brought him to their home, Pretty Penny, by the Hudson River in New York. His father was always angry whenever stories in the newspaper referred to James as their "adopted son." James MacArthur, who has died aged 72, was instantly identified with Detective Danny "Danno" Williams in the long-running television series Hawaii Five-O (1968-79), in which he was habitually told "Book 'em, Danno" by his superior officer, Detective Steve McGarrett (Jack Lord), after villains had been captured. His mother, Helen Hayes, always flagged as "the first lady of the theatre", had a long career on stage, in television and films, winning two Oscars 40 years apart, and his father, Charles MacArthur, co-wrote and co-directed several films with Ben Hecht, one of which, The Scoundrel (1935), won a screenplay Oscar, though the writing team was most famous for the classic Broadway comedy, The Front Page (1928), filmed several times. what kind of cancer did james macarthur die from. This became a feature film (Frankenheimer's first) entitled The Young Stranger (1957), in which MacArthur, impressive in his first movie, plays a moody teenage rebel with a cause and a crewcut, whose neglect by his parents leads to his getting into trouble with the police.
